Surajpura

Surajpura is a village located in Jabera tehsil of Damoh district in Madhya Pradesh, India. It is situated 32km away from sub-district headquarter Jabera (tehsildar office) and 74km away from district headquarter Damoh. As per 2009 stats, Salaiyabadi is the gram panchayat of Surajpura village.

About Surajpura

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Surajpura is 462609. The village spans a total geographical area of 173.09 hectares. Jabera is nearest town to Surajpura village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 32km away.

Population of Surajpura

According to the 2011 Census, Surajpura has a total population of about 550, with approximately 285 males and 265 females. The sex ratio is around 929 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 121 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 9 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. The Scheduled Tribes (ST) population numbers around 506. The overall literacy rate is approximately 45.82%, with male literacy at about 51.23% and female literacy near 40.00%. There are around 110 households in the village. Connectivity of Surajpura

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Surajpura. As per the 2011 stats, Surajpura had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within 10+ km distance
Private Bus Service Available within 10+ km distance
Railway Station Available within 10+ km distance
